C20 RPK is a 2008 Porsche Boxster in Blue with a 3,387c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 21 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 81%.
Across all 2008 Porsche Boxster models, the average MOT pass rate is 88.3% with a typical mileage of 43,747 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Porsche Boxster f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 19,504 recorded failures. If you're considering buying C20 RPK,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Porsche Boxster typically stays on UK roads for around 29 years. At 18 years old, this Porsche Boxster is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
